Discover MakerZone

MATLAB and Simulink resources for Arduino, LEGO, and Raspberry Pi

Learn more

Discover what MATLAB® can do for your career.

Opportunities for recent engineering grads.

Apply Today

Problem 926. Unique: Speed Enhancement for uint(8,16,32)

Created by Richard Zapor

This Speed Performance Challenge is to optimize Unique for processing uint8/uint16/uint32 variables.

Input: A (column vector of uint8/uint16/uint32)

Output: B (column vector A processed by unique "like" function)

Scoring: Cumulative time, in msec, of "unique" processing of three medium size arrays.

Examples: [5;4;3;2;2;1] returns [1;2;3;4;5], and Fast

Hint: Help Unique, Legacy, Options

Tags

Problem Group

Solution Statistics

18 correct solutions 6 incorrect solutions
Last solution submitted on Jan 21, 2013

Problem Comments